P57 KKN is a 1997 Subaru Impreza in Blue with a 1,994c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 78.9%.
Across all 1997 Subaru Impreza models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.2% with a typical mileage of 106,850 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Subaru Impreza f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 28,062 recorded failures. If you're considering buying P57 KKN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Subaru Impreza typically stays on UK roads for around 33 years. At 29 years old, this Subaru Impreza is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
